FAQs about our activity holidays

What types of activity holidays are there?

There are all sorts of activity holidays you can go on abroad with Exodus. Whether your thing is trekking, canoeing, skiing or cycling, you can find trips with the activity focus you want. A lot of our holidays roll several activities into one so that you get a great, all-round experience. Will you zip-line through a jungle, trek a mountain range, or try out some snorkelling?

We also have a great selection of mixed-activity family-friendly holidays with opportunities to explore at an appropriate ability level (see each individual package to get an idea of the minimum age appropriate for the trip).

How are the activities graded?

You’ll notice we’ve given each of our activity trips a “leisurely”, “moderate” or “challenging” rating. This is to give you a good idea of what to expect from your holidays so that you don’t turn up and find it’s too much or too little for your taste. As a guideline, all trips require a certain level of good health and enjoyment of the outdoors. You can read more to find out how our grading system works in full detail.

We’ve also put together some handy guides to help you prepare for your activity holidays and make sure your fitness is up to scratch before you go. These complement our activity grading system and we recommend you take a look.

What age groups are suitable for your activity holidays?

This depends on which holiday you’re looking at. If you’re bringing the whole family, including children, you may want to look at our family activity holidays specifically.

At the other end of the spectrum, we have challenging hikes for experienced walkers aged 16 and above, such as our Everest Base Camp treks. Most of our cycling holidays are also 16+.

If in doubt, simply consult the age recommended at the top of the page of the holiday you’ve got your eye on!

What do I need to wear for an activity holiday?

This has a lot to do with the activities you expect to participate in and the climate. As a rule, sturdy walking shoes that you’ve broken in are an essential. If you’re going on a winter holiday or something that involves boating, you should consult the overview tab to see if any additional equipment is provided by us, or if you need to bring it yourself.

Please be aware that even if you’re going on an activity holiday abroad to a region that generally has a warm climate, your adventure may take you to higher altitudes where the temperature can drop or where colder nights might be common. Wherever you go, it’s always wise to bring layers!

Are the trips guided?

We offer a mix of guided and self-guided trips. Some people love to travel in groups and others prefer to go at their own pace, so we’ve taken this into account and designed amazing activity holidays for every type of traveller.

If you’re eying up a specific holiday, it should indicate whether the trip is guided or self-guided in the “Ways to Travel” field at the top of the page. Some holidays also offer the option to travel in a private group with people you know only.

What are the groups like?

If you choose to travel as part of one of our guided groups, you’ll probably find it’s a mix of solo travellers, couples and friends. This can be a really enriching experience; in fact, it sometimes results in travellers making new life-long friends who they plan future trips with!

Itinerary The trip was really great–I loved the diversity of going to smaller, traditional places as well as the modern cities. There were times when I thought we would have more free time than we did–Kyoto (tour activities ended at approx. 3:30), Kobe (arrived 1 hr before the gardens closed so didn’t go), and Hiroshima (tour activities ended at approx 4 pm). I loved all of the places that we went too–in retrospect I would have added additional days in Kyoto (I arrived a day in advance) and benefitted greatly from my flight home being delayed giving me a full extra day in Toyko that I hadn’t planned for. The tour is very fast pace and you do walk alot–so just bring a really good pair of running shoes with you! Hotels All were good–my favourite was Hotel Toyko in Takayama. I rented a private onsen for an hour which was very nice and enjoyed the unique art they had on each floor. I really appreciated the washer/dryer in the hotel room–while I had enough clothes it was nice to wash them and be able to go out for dinner at the same time and not feel in a rush to get back to the room (it was free and they did provide soap if you don’t have any). The hotels in Kyoto and Tokyo were nice as well–the first modern and the last traditional. All of the hotels were really clean, provided great breakfasts, and had toiletries if you forget any (and if you wanted pjs to wear). Transportation The bullet trains were very cool as were all of the trains. They are very prompt! The subway system is easy to manoever–I used Google Maps to tell me what stop to get off and where to walk and never got lost (even in Toyko). The trains are very quiet and clean–getting onto and off public transit is done in lines so there never is a rush and in most cases the train/subway cars were empty. The bus system in Kyoto makes getting between places slow so factor that in. Also, the connection from Osaka to Kyoto was pretty easy to do but made harder with getting off a transatlantic flight. Doing this again, I would fly direct into Tokyo and then get to Kyoto the next day. Felt very safe and comfortable walking around by myself–even in the evening. The locals are very helpful if you want to confirm directions. Food I am normally a very fussy eater and I didn’t have a problem finding things to eat. In fact, I wish I had more time in Kyoto in the traditional area to have some of the different food options the shops offered. I also didn’t have time to get a hot drink from a dispensing machine! I found breakfast made me full and then we would go somewhere at dinner that would fill me up (I often had noodle dishes). I would have been ok finding my own dinner in Takayama instead of group meals–the different styles of eating were good to experience. While I liked going out to eat with the group, it was tough having to have the bill together–it would have been easier to be able to pay for my own food.
julie hannah Ancient & Modern Japan

Although I travelled from quite far away, (Vancouver Island, Canada), I was so very pleased at the kindness and friendly attitude of everyone in the group. I was the eldest in the group (73 years young), but had absolutely no trouble keeping up. I would say this trip is not for the feint of heart; even at the end of October/early November the days were quite hot (although the evening temps were perfect). We experienced no bugs and no rain throughout the week. Definitely expect long days and some arduous climbs as well as steep descents. Hiking poles were essential. It was occasionally windy and cool at each summit but I was able to hike in shorts all week. I’m quite used to climbing mountains and found this itinerary to be just perfect. The accommodation was basic but comfortable; the food was good but at times limited for me as a vegetarian. Breakfasts outside were fantastic and the triple-decker sandwiches that José made for us were to die for. You definitely won’t be disappointed.

Lucy Goodbrand Hike Spain's Sierra de Aitana
